COMMERCIAL DESCRIPTION
This light bodied lager is brewed with pale malts and Yakima hops to achieve a light yet satisfying flavor.

Found this at the local Circle K for $5.99 for 12 cans. Poured yellow with a good foamy head that faded fast. Aroma of light corn. Flavor is not bad at all, especially for a light beer. Easy drinking and no bad aftertaste. I could drink a lot of these on a hot Arizona day...and fast!

Nice golden color,small foamy whitye head that actually had a decent hang time for swill.Lightly malty aroma with a slight corny side and a very faint hint of hops in the background.kind of sweet and watery tasting with a faint hint of hops in the end but mainly the brew is ruled by sweetness.Not real terrible in fact it is a fine lawnmower brew but for quaffability it’s not there at all,but 2.99/12 pack you can’t go wrong eather.It’s worth a try but mainly for those nights when you don’t care what you imbibe.
